WebDec 7, 2024 · Amelanchier lamarckii in full blossom with copper leaves unfurling. And about those fireworks! In March or April soft, white starlike blossoms emerge from the reddish buds, covering the tree. The arrival of the flowers is closely followed by the leaves which first appear as small, tightly curled pink prawnlike shapes arching from the branches.
WebAmelanchier stolonifera Phonetic Spelling am-uh-LAN-kee-er spi-KAY-tuh Description Dwarf Serviceberry is a small, native, deciduous shrub in the rose family found in disturbed sites, meadows, forest edges and fields. It is native to the coastal and Piedmont regions of NC. This shrub grows 3-5 feet tall and wide and can form dense thickets.
